It is with great sadness and heavy hearts to share our news of the sudden but peaceful passing of our husband, father & grandfather Steve William Babakaiff at Hardy View Lodge on Thursday, March 17, 2022.
Steve was born on November 23,1943 to William and Alice Babakaiff in Grand Forks. He often told people that he was found in July Creek above Spencer Hill, it flowed where he grew up.
He was employed as an Administrator/Accountant at the USCC and Sion Improvement District for many years. He was extremely active throughout his life and very proud of his community & served on many committees. He was a member of the Rotary Club, serving two terms as President and became an honorary member. He was a member of the Elks Lodge, Independent Order of Foresters, Director on the Hospital Board, involved in introducing Russian news and programs to CKGF Radio. He served as the only member from B.C. on the Canadian Consultative Council on Multiculturalism of 100 members throughout Canada. He was involved in the first official opening of the Grand Forks airport and served on the Association of B.C. Irrigation District receiving several awards.
Steve is survived by his loving wife Nina of 50 years, their children Gail (Kevin) Horne, Candice (Matt), Chris (Kaylin), grandchildren Kayleigh and Kolby Horne and Rayne Babakaiff , brother Bill, sister in-law Molly, several nieces, nephews and extended family.
He was predeceased by his mother, Alice (Strelaeff) in 1980, father William in 1986 and brother Edward in 2017.
